The Core Strategy: What Actually Works
Here’s what AimGlobal Digital consistently implements for local business clients to rank in Google AI Overviews:
- Build location-specific service pages. One generic services page won’t cut it anymore. AI systems prefer specificity — “Luxury Car Service Center in Bangalore” over just “car service.” The more localized your content, the stronger your relevance signal.
- Add FAQ sections to every service page. FAQ content is the bread and butter of AI-generated answers. Questions like “Is non-surgical hair replacement permanent?” or “Do you use OEM parts?” get pulled directly into Google AI Overviews for local businesses. If you’re not answering them, your competitor will be.
- Optimize your Google Business Profile completely. Accurate NAP (Name, Address, Phone), updated hours, photos, service descriptions, and review responses — Google AI relies heavily on GBP data when generating local recommendations. Don’t leave it half-filled.
- Collect reviews that tell a story. “Great service” is nearly useless in 2026. A review that says “Excellent Yamaha bike purchase experience in Bangalore” gives AI systems rich contextual signals. Guide your customers toward specific, descriptive language.
- Use structured data markup. Schema for local businesses, FAQs, reviews, and services helps Google’s AI understand what you do and where — faster and more accurately. It’s not optional anymore.
- Show your E-E-A-T signals clearly. Years of experience, certifications, awards, industry affiliations — these are trust signals that AI systems actively weigh when deciding whose content to surface.
